    According to our (Global Info Research) latest study, the global Ion Exchange Chromatography Packing Material market size was valued at US$ 720 million in 2025 and is forecast to a readjusted size of US$ 1014 million by 2032 with a CAGR of 5.5% during review period.
    In 2025, global sales of Ion Exchange Chromatography Packing Material reached approximately 350,000 liters, with an average market price of about USD 2,000 per liter, an annual production capacity of roughly 390,000 liters, and an industry-average gross margin of approximately 25%.
    Ion Exchange Chromatography Packing Material refers to functional chromatography media or resins used in ion-exchange separation and purification. These materials are typically built on porous polymer, agarose, dextran, or synthetic matrices with positively or negatively charged ligands immobilized on the surface, enabling adsorption, elution, and separation according to the net charge of target molecules. They can be divided into anion-exchange and cation-exchange media, and further into strong and weak ion exchangers. They are widely used for the capture and polishing of proteins, antibodies, nucleic acids, vaccine intermediates, and other charged biomolecules, making them one of the most fundamental media types in downstream bioprocessing.
    Upstream of this industry are matrix materials such as agarose, dextran, methacrylate, and styrenic polymers, along with ligands/functional groups, crosslinkers, activation reagents, buffer salts, solvents, and chromatography column hardware. The midstream consists of ion-exchange media manufacturers that carry out matrix synthesis, surface activation, ligand coupling, particle-size control, column compatibility design, and quality validation. Downstream demand mainly comes from biopharmaceutical companies, CDMOs, vaccine manufacturers, blood-product producers, research institutes, and analytical laboratories, with major use cases in the capture, impurity removal, and polishing of monoclonal antibodies, recombinant proteins, nucleic-acid therapeutics, and vaccines.
